Budgie đã và đang làm việc để tự giới thiệu mình như một dự án hoàn toàn độc lập

Joshua Stroble, người gần đây đã nghỉ việc phân phối Solus và thành lập tổ chức độc lập Buddies Of Budgie, đã công bố kế hoạch để phát triển hơn nữa môi trường máy tính để bàn búp bê.

Trong bài đăng của bạn, bạn đề cập rằng chi nhánh Budgie 10.x sẽ tiếp tục phát triển để cung cấp các thành phần generics độc lập với phân phối. Các gói đi kèm với Budgie Desktop, Budgie Control Center, Budgie Desktop View và Budgie Screensaver đang được cung cấp để đưa vào kho lưu trữ Fedora Linux và một bản mở rộng Fedora với một máy tính để bàn Budgie tương tự được lên kế hoạch cho tương lai với phiên bản Ubuntu Budgie .

Chi nhánh Budgie 11 sẽ phát triển theo hướng tách biệt của lớp với việc triển khai chức năng chính của màn hình nền và lớp cung cấp trực quan hóa và xuất thông tin.

sự tách biệt như vậy sẽ cho phép trừu tượng hóa mã thư viện và các công cụ đồ họa cụ thể, cũng như bắt đầu thử nghiệm với các mô hình khác để trình bày thông tin và kết nối các hệ thống đầu ra khác. Ví dụ, có thể bắt đầu thử nghiệm với quá trình chuyển đổi đã được lên kế hoạch trước đó sang bộ thư viện EFL (Thư viện Tổ chức Khai sáng) do dự án Khai sáng phát triển.

Ngoài ra, người ta đề cập rằng công việc sẽ được thực hiện để cung cấp hỗ trợ cốt lõi cho giao thức Wayland trong khi vẫn giữ X11 như một tùy chọn (dành cho người dùng cạc đồ họa NVIDIA có thể gặp sự cố với hỗ trợ của Wayland).

Nó cũng được lên kế hoạch thúc đẩy việc sử dụng mã Rust trong các thư viện và trình quản lý cửa sổ (phần chính sẽ vẫn trong C, nhưng Rust sẽ được sử dụng cho các khu vực quan trọng).

thêm vào đó cài đặt trước được cung cấp bố cục bảng điều khiển và màn hình nền, bao gồm giao diện GNOME Shell, macOS, Unity và Windows 11, menu và bố cục bảng điều khiển. Có thể đính kèm các giao diện trình khởi chạy ứng dụng bên ngoài.

Cũng được cải thiện hỗ trợ cho vị trí biểu tượng trên màn hình, khả năng đặt và nhóm các biểu tượng tùy ý và cải thiện hỗ trợ bố trí cửa sổ xếp gạch (điều chỉnh ngang và dọc, phân chia cửa sổ 2 × 2, 1 × 3 và 3 × một).

người khác kế hoạch và mục tiêu cho Budgie 11 bao gồm:

  • Cung cấp giao diện để chuyển đổi giữa các ứng dụng theo kiểu GNOME Shell và các chế độ tổng quan của macOS.
  • Nhận dạng đầy đủ chức năng với Budgie 10 ở cấp độ hỗ trợ applet.
  • Trình quản lý màn hình ảo mới với hỗ trợ kéo các cửa sổ sang màn hình khác và khả năng liên kết các lần khởi chạy ứng dụng với một màn hình cụ thể.
  • Sử dụng nó để làm việc với cài đặt định dạng TOML thay vì cài đặt.
  • Khả năng thích ứng của bảng điều khiển để sử dụng trong các thiết lập nhiều màn hình, khả năng định vị bảng điều khiển động khi kết nối các màn hình bổ sung.
  • Các tùy chọn menu mở rộng, hỗ trợ các chế độ menu thay thế như lưới biểu tượng và điều hướng toàn màn hình thông qua các ứng dụng hiện có.
  • Trung tâm điều khiển cấu hình mới.
  • Hỗ trợ làm việc trên các hệ thống có kiến ​​trúc RISC-V và mở rộng hỗ trợ cho các hệ thống ARM.
    Sự phát triển tích cực của chi nhánh Budgie 11 sẽ bắt đầu sau khi hoàn thành việc điều chỉnh chi nhánh Budgie 10 cho nhu cầu phân phối.

Trong khi kế hoạch cho sự phát triển của Budgie 10:

  • Chuẩn bị cho Hỗ trợ của Wayland
  • Chuyển các chức năng theo dõi (lập chỉ mục) của các ứng dụng sang một thư viện riêng biệt, được sử dụng trong các nhánh 10 và 11
  • Loại bỏ gnome-bluetooth có lợi cho một loạt bluez trở lên
  • Ngừng sử dụng libgvc (Thư viện điều khiển khối lượng GNOME) thay vì API của Pipewire và MediaSession
  • Chuyển hộp thoại khởi chạy sang chương trình phụ trợ lập chỉ mục ứng dụng mới
  • Tham gia vào applet cấu hình mạng libnm và D-Bus API NetworkManager
  • Làm lại việc triển khai thực đơn
  • Đánh giá quản lý nguồn điện
  • Viết lại mã gỉ để nhập và xuất cấu hình
  • Cải thiện khả năng tương thích với các tiêu chuẩn FreeDesktop
  • Cải tiến bộ điều khiển Applet
  • Thêm khả năng làm việc với các chủ đề EFL và Qt.

Cuối cùng, nếu bạn muốn biết thêm về nó, bạn có thể tham khảo chi tiết trong ấn phẩm gốc. trong liên kết này.


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: AB Internet Networks 2008 SL
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.